Disney Audtions

Disney is holding an open call for college students who perform musical theater for their Broadway-caliber, theatrical production of Aladdin -- A Musical Spectacular. Auditions will be held on Thursday and Friday.

Claudia Escobar, a theater major at Cerritos College, stated, "I auditioned for Disney before, but haven't been lucky enough to get cast yet." She plans to read for the lead role of Jasmine.

According to Escobar, she is very nervous about the audition and plans to work with Robin Huber, a theater professor at Cerritos College, for direction and feedback. She hopes that working with him will increase her chances.

The show will be directed by the award-winning director Francesca Zambello and choreographed by acclaimed Broadway choreographer Lynne Taylor-Corbott.

Aladdin will be performed in the state-of-the-art, indoor 2,000-seat Hyperion Theater at Disney's California Adventure Park.
